Output e432778f87c1c93feada757ed9b90123c029c04ecbdf54870a1668d71bd8007e:3

value
39674614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e36706945f367b4a77bc748ad6c9623747df3b9 OP_EQUAL
address
MC7WXkSc7WYMocQfdSgq9EwZmqctr3qxAc
transaction
e432778f87c1c93feada757ed9b90123c029c04ecbdf54870a1668d71bd8007e
spent
true